David M. Sansom is a scholar working on Immunology, Oncology and Genetics. According to data from OpenAlex, David M. Sansom has authored 104 papers receiving a total of 9.6k indexed citations (citations by other indexed papers that have themselves been cited), including 87 papers in Immunology, 20 papers in Oncology and 12 papers in Genetics. Recurrent topics in David M. Sansom's work include T-cell and B-cell Immunology (69 papers), Immune Cell Function and Interaction (64 papers) and Immunotherapy and Immune Responses (19 papers). David M. Sansom is often cited by papers focused on T-cell and B-cell Immunology (69 papers), Immune Cell Function and Interaction (64 papers) and Immunotherapy and Immune Responses (19 papers). David M. Sansom collaborates with scholars based in United Kingdom, United States and Canada. David M. Sansom's co-authors include Lucy S. K. Walker, Yong Zheng, Neil Halliday, Behzad Rowshanravan, Claire N. Manzotti, Louisa Jeffery, Omar Qureshi, Fiona Burke, Tie Zheng Hou and Zoe Briggs and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.
